ABS-CBN launches “Thank You sa Malasakit: Pope Francis sa Pilipinas” campaign

LionhearTVBy LionhearTVDecember 25, 2014No Comments3 Mins Read
Share
Facebook Twitter Reddit Pinterest Email

ABS-CBN rallies the Filipino people to become living testimonies of Pope Francis’ message of compassion and mercy through its “Thank You sa Malasakit: Pope Francis sa Pilipinas” campaign, which was launched last Tuesday (Dec 16) to mark a 30-day countdown to the papal visit in January.

At the ‘Piyesta Para sa Santo Papa’ organized by “Bayan Mo, iPatrol Mo” at La Consolacion College, ABS-CBN urged Filipinos to express their gratitude to Pope Francis, who has blessed the nation with the message of humility, and to practice mercy and compassion in their daily lives.

By using ABS-CBN’s official hashtag #PopeTYSM (Pope Thank You Sa Malasakit) on social media, netizens can send their personal messages, prayers, pledges, or poems to give thanks to the Pope. These posts have a chance to be included in ABS-CBN’s Book of Thanks that will be given to Pope Francis upon his departure.

Use the hashtag #PopeTYSM when posting your prayer or message for Pope FrancisAll posts on Twitter and Facebook with the hashtag #PopeTYSM are published on www.abs-cbnnews.com/popefrancisphwall.

ABS-CBN’s PopeTYSM booth will also be placed in in key areas around the country. In it, Filipinos can record their special thank you message for Pope Francis.

By tuning in to ABS-CBN, ANC, DZMM Radyo Patrol Sais Trenta and DZMM TeleRadyo everyday, Filipinos can get the latest updates on the preparations for the papal visit, as well as special reports featuring people who have been inspired by the Pope.

Pope Francis’followers online can also stay up-to-date on the Papal visit activities by visiting ABS-CBNNews.com, anc.yahoo.com, and dzmm.com.ph. Meanwhile, www.abs-cbnnews.com/PopeFrancisPH aggregates all the special articles, multimedia features, and TV reports about Pope Francis that were aired on “TV Patrol,” “Bandila,” and “Umagang Kay Ganda.”

This December, documentary program “Mukha” takes a peek into the lives and stories of people who have personally met or encountered Pope Francis. These include Archbishop Socrates Villegas, the president of the Catholic Bishop’s Conference of the Philippines; Bishop Bong Baylon, the popular “selfie bishop” who took the once-in-a-lifetime chance to take a picture with Pope Francis (airing Dec 18 on ANC and Dec 22 on ABS-CBN); healing priest Fr. Joey Faller, who grabbed the Pope’s attention during his visit to the Vatican (Dec 25 on ANC and Dec 29 on ABS-CBN); and Fr. Rico Ayo, who had his own “selfie” experience with the Pope when he volunteered in the synod in Rome (Jan 1 on ANC and Jan 5 on ABS-CBN).

In January 2015, ABS-CBN Sunday’s Best will air weekly specials about the life of Pope Francis and the coming papal visit.
